BEACON FALLS — The Board of Selectmen last week appointed Beacon Hose Company No. 1 Chief Brian DeGeorge and Capt. Cal Brennan as the town’s fire marshal and deputy fire marshal, respectively.

DeGeorge and Brennan both recently completed the state requirements to be a fire marshal. They are replacing Keith Griffin, who served as the fire marshal since last June. Griffin is the fire marshal in Prospect.

“I think me and Cal can do some good and learn a lot more,” DeGeorge said. “It’s definitely another side of the spectrum that were used to, and I think it’s going to be a good thing.”

DeGeorge and Brennan will share the fire marshal responsibilities, which include investigating fires and conducting inspections of buildings in town. First Selectman Christopher Bielik said there is a total of 10 hours a week for both positions combined and the pay is $25 an hour.
